[Mailman-Users] Permission Denied Error after List Migration

Stephen J. Turnbull turnbull at sk.tsukuba.ac.jp
Wed Aug 6 08:38:34 CEST 2014


Sascha Rissel writes:

 > (N.B: All file permissions are set according to my previous server's, but I
 > also tried: "chown -R list.list /var/lib/mailman/lists/""

Try running the bin/check_perms script (or maybe it's checkperms).
The wrapper scripts may have a different idea from you about file
owners etc.
 > 
 > Can you help me?
 > 
 > Regards,
 > Sascha.
 > 
 > > Aug 05 19:53:33 2014 (21848) Failed config.pck write, retaining old state.
 > > [Errno 13] Permission denied:
 > '/var/lib/mailman/lists/rcworms-ah/config.pck.tmp.euve51864.serverprofi24.de.21848'
 > > Aug 05 19:53:33 2014 admin(21848):
 > @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
 > > admin(21848): [----- Mailman Version: 2.1.15 -----]
 > > admin(21848): [----- Traceback ------]
 > > admin(21848): Traceback (most recent call last):
 > > admin(21848):   File "/var/lib/mailman/scripts/driver", line 112, in
 > run_main
 > > admin(21848):     main()
 > > admin(21848):   File "/var/lib/mailman/Mailman/Cgi/admin.py", line 227,
 > in main
 > > admin(21848):     mlist.Save()
 > > admin(21848):   File "/var/lib/mailman/Mailman/MailList.py", line 573, in
 > Save
 > > admin(21848):     self.__save(dict)
 > > admin(21848):   File "/var/lib/mailman/Mailman/MailList.py", line 528, in
 > __save
 > > admin(21848):     fp = open(fname_tmp, 'w')
 > > admin(21848): IOError: [Errno 13] Permission denied:
 > '/var/lib/mailman/lists/rcworms-ah/config.pck.tmp.euve51864.serverprofi24.de.21848'
 > > admin(21848): [----- Python Information -----]
 > > admin(21848): sys.version     =   2.7.3 (default, Mar 13 2014, 11:03:55)
 > > [GCC 4.7.2]
 > > admin(21848): sys.executable  =   /usr/bin/python
 > > admin(21848): sys.prefix      =   /usr
 > > admin(21848): sys.exec_prefix =   /usr
 > > admin(21848): sys.path        =   ['/var/lib/mailman/pythonlib',
 > '/var/lib/mailman', '/usr/lib/mailman/scripts', '/var/lib/mailman',
 > '/usr/lib/python2.7/', '/usr/lib/python2.7/plat-linux2',
 > '/usr/lib/python2.7/lib-tk', '/usr/lib/python2.7/lib-old',
 > '/usr/lib/python2.7/lib-dynload', '/usr/lib/python2.7/site-packages']
 > > admin(21848): sys.platform    =   linux2
 > > admin(21848): [----- Environment Variables -----]
 > > admin(21848):     HTTP_COOKIE:
 > > admin(21848):     SERVER_SOFTWARE: Apache
 > > admin(21848):     SCRIPT_NAME: /mailman/admin
 > > admin(21848):     SERVER_SIGNATURE: <address>Apache Server at
 > lists.euve51864.serverprofi24.de Port 80</address>
 > > admin(21848):
 > > admin(21848):     REQUEST_METHOD: GET
 > > admin(21848):     PATH_INFO: /rcworms-ah
 > > admin(21848):     SERVER_PROTOCOL: HTTP/1.1
 > > admin(21848):     QUERY_STRING: adminpw=AH_MAILAdmin
 > > admin(21848):     HTTP_USER_AGENT: Mozilla/5.0 (Windows NT 6.3; WOW64;
 > rv:31.0) Gecko/20100101 Firefox/31.0
 > > admin(21848):     HTTP_CONNECTION: keep-alive
 > > admin(21848):     SERVER_NAME: lists.euve51864.serverprofi24.de
 > > admin(21848):     REMOTE_ADDR: 95.88.111.84
 > > admin(21848):     PATH_TRANSLATED:
 > /var/www/vhosts/default/htdocs/rcworms-ah
 > > admin(21848):     SERVER_PORT: 80
 > > admin(21848):     SERVER_ADDR: 62.75.175.182
 > > admin(21848):     DOCUMENT_ROOT: /var/www/vhosts/default/htdocs
 > > admin(21848):     PYTHONPATH: /var/lib/mailman
 > > admin(21848):     SCRIPT_FILENAME: /usr/lib/cgi-bin/mailman/admin
 > > admin(21848):     SERVER_ADMIN: webmaster at rc-worms.de
 > > admin(21848):     HTTP_DNT: 1
 > > admin(21848):     HTTP_HOST: lists.euve51864.serverprofi24.de
 > > admin(21848):     REQUEST_URI:
 > /mailman/admin/rcworms-ah?adminpw=AH_MAILAdmin
 > > admin(21848):     HTTP_ACCEPT:
 > text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8
 > > admin(21848):     GATEWAY_INTERFACE: CGI/1.1
 > > admin(21848):     REMOTE_PORT: 50425
 > > admin(21848):     HTTP_ACCEPT_LANGUAGE:
 > de-de,de;q=0.8,en-us;q=0.5,en;q=0.3
 > > admin(21848):     HTTP_ACCEPT_ENCODING: gzip, deflate
 > ------------------------------------------------------
 > Mailman-Users mailing list Mailman-Users at python.org
 > https://mail.python.org/mailman/listinfo/mailman-users
 > Mailman FAQ: http://wiki.list.org/x/AgA3
 > Security Policy: http://wiki.list.org/x/QIA9
 > Searchable Archives: http://www.mail-archive.com/mailman-users%40python.org/
 > Unsubscribe: https://mail.python.org/mailman/options/mailman-users/stephen%40xemacs.org


More information about the Mailman-Users mailing list